How does Price know Makarov in MW2?

Laswell hands Price a picture of someone she thinks is new and is working with the Russians. Captain Price recognizes the person in question and passes the picture to the rest of Task Force 141, who are shown sitting next to him. Price then turns to Laswell, revealing that this man is none other than Vladimir Makarov.

What does No Russian mean in MW2?

"No Russian" begins with the player in an elevator with Makarov and three other gunmen. Makarov tells the group "Remember, no Russian" - an instruction to only speak English in order to frame the attack as being committed by Americans; the group also uses American weaponry.

Why did Makarov hate Price?

According to the newspaper clippings in his safehouse, Vladimir Makarov held the photos up of Bravo Six (Gaz, Griggs, Price and John "Soap" MacTavish) and declared they were responsible for the death of Imran Zakhaev. Most likely, it was for this reason why he held a grudge against Price and Soap.

Did Shepard tip off Makarov?

Shepherd tips off Makarov that Allen is American, so it solidifies Makarov's plan to spark a war between America and Russia. He kills Allen before they escape, leaving Allen's corpse to be found by Russian authorities.

How did Soap know Yuri knew Makarov?

Soap pushed Yuri out of a window to save him and Soap caught on to Makarov's knowledge of Yuri. Yuri aided Price in rushing Soap to a nearby building only for Soap to reveal Makarov's knowledge of Yuri to Price seconds before his death.

Why is Soap called Soap?

Here, it is revealed that Soap got his nickname not because he is fastidious in the shower, but because he is good at "cleaning house". In fact, this is something he does with "remarkable speed and accuracy in room clearance techniques and urban warfare tactics".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 2's accolades trailer.
